Practical Seller Notes and Technical Considerations

Before you rush to list products using the Cute Chick Umbrella Embroidery, there are several practical steps you must take to ensure success. As a digital product delivered in ZIP or RAR format, you will receive the files instantly after purchase, but you must verify the specifics on the Creative Fabrica product page before committing to a production run.

  1. Test the Design: Always create a sample stitch-out on the exact fabric you plan to sell. Do not assume the design will look the same on cotton as it does on fleece.
  2. Check Hoop Size: Confirm the dimensions of the design to ensure it fits within your machine's hoop. You do not want to discover mid-production that the design requires a larger hoop than you currently own.
  3. Review Stitch Density: Examine the stitch density closely. If the areas are too dense, they may pucker thin fabrics like baby cloth or tea towels. If they are too sparse, the design might lack definition.
  4. Select Thread Colors: Experiment with different thread colors to see what pops best. Pastels might suit a baby theme, while brighter yellows and blues could work better for adult apparel.
  5. Verify Licensing: While many Creative Fabrica embroidery files allow for the sale of finished goods, always double-check the specific license terms associated with this file. Ensure you are compliant with their rules regarding finished product sales.
  6. Stabilizer Choice: Determine the best stabilizer for your chosen fabric. A good stabilizer ensures the embroidery file stitches cleanly without distortion.

Remember, since this is a digital product, no physical item will be shipped, and there are typically no returns or refunds for digital downloads. This means the responsibility falls on you, the seller, to test thoroughly before investing in materials for your inventory.
